The Office of Information Technology is continuing the process of upgrading existing University antivirus software, in buildings (44, 67, and 67B), from Symantec Endpoint Protection to Microsoft System Center 2012 Endpoint Protection. This will be done tonight around 11:00PM as part of our regular patch and maintenance cycle. After the software is installed, it may be necessary to restart the machine up to two times to finish the installation.
System Center Endpoint Protection is known for its industry-leading malware detection, guarding against the latest malware and rootkits. This process is seamless to the users and we do not anticipate any downtime.
